Beautiful location, peaceful ambience and a walk through some lovely countryside to spend a day in Durham. Showers/toilets/potwash facilities were spotless and hot water plentiful. My only gripe is other campers not separating their rubbish and so we had to take our recycling home as the designated bins were stuffed with large bags of mixed rubbish. Not the campsite's fault though.

We booked a pod at Finchale Abbey last minute, and it turned out to be one of the most relaxing breaks we’ve had. The free firewood was a lovely bonus and made the evening even more enjoyable. The whole site was spotless, and our pod was clean, comfortable, and well looked after. What really stood out was how peaceful it was—you could hear nothing but the sounds of wildlife, which made it the perfect place to switch off and unwind. We honestly had the most chilled time and left feeling completely recharged. We wouldn’t hesitate to come back and would highly recommend it to anyone looking for a quiet, relaxing getaway.
